What a Garden Coach Actually Does

If you’ve ever stood in the middle of a garden center feeling overwhelmed—or worse, spent weeks planting a garden that never really took off—you’re not alone. That’s exactly where a garden coach comes in. Most people are familiar with the idea of a personal trainer or a life coach, but a garden coach? That’s still a new concept to many. In short, a garden coach is your personal guide to growing a successful, beautiful, and productive garden—one that fits your lifestyle, budget, and Florida’s unique climate.

A garden coach doesn’t show up with a mower or a truck full of sod. Instead, we partner with you to help you learn, plan, and grow. Think of it like having a GPS for your gardening journey—we plot the route together, and I help you avoid costly mistakes or dead ends along the way. Depending on your needs, I might help you choose the best location for your garden, teach you how to improve your sandy Florida soil, guide you through plant selection based on your goals, create a custom planting plan for the season, or offer support when pests, weeds, or confusion creep in. Whether you’re starting fresh or trying to revive a forgotten garden bed, I’m here to walk beside you so you feel confident and capable at every step.

One of my favorite examples is a recent client who believed, “nothing grows in my yard.” She had a side yard full of sandy soil and struggling shrubs but dreamed of harvesting herbs and salad greens. We walked the space together, chose a sunnier spot, amended the soil, and built a seasonal plan. A few months later, she sent me a photo of her first homegrown salad: arugula, baby kale, cherry tomatoes, and basil. The smile on her face said more than any testimonial ever could. That’s what garden coaching is about—helping you go from unsure to overjoyed, one step at a time.

It’s also worth clarifying what a garden coach is not. I’m not a landscape installer, a lawn service, or a one-size-fits-all garden template provider. Coaching is personal, flexible, and focused on empowering you to create a space that feels like your own. I don’t just tell you what to plant—I help you understand why, so you can make smarter choices in every season going forward.
